200字范文,内容丰富有趣,生活中的好帮手!
200字范文 > Web开发者必备轻松配置MySQL连接池 让你的网站流畅无阻 mysql服务无法启动 1058

Web开发者必备轻松配置MySQL连接池 让你的网站流畅无阻 mysql服务无法启动 1058

时间:2020-11-13 21:33:36

相关推荐

Web开发者必备轻松配置MySQL连接池 让你的网站流畅无阻 mysql服务无法启动 1058

MySQL连接池是Web开发中非常重要的组件之一,它可以提高网站的性能和稳定性。但是,对于初学者来说,配置MySQL连接池可能会有些困难。本文将为您详细介绍如何轻松配置MySQL连接池,让您的网站流畅无阻。

一、什么是MySQL连接池?

MySQL连接池是一种数据库连接管理技术,它可以在应用程序和MySQL服务器之间建立一个连接池。当应用程序需要与MySQL服务器通信时,它可以从连接池中获取一个连接,而不是每次都重新建立一个连接。这样可以避免频繁地建立和关闭连接,从而提高性能和稳定性。

二、为什么需要MySQL连接池?

在Web开发中,应用程序需要频繁地访问数据库,而每次访问都需要建立一个新的连接。这样会导致服务器的负载增加,同时也会降低应用程序的性能和稳定性。使用MySQL连接池可以避免这个问题,因为连接池中已经预先建立好了一些连接,应用程序可以直接从连接池中获取连接,从而减少了连接的建立和关闭次数。

三、如何配置MySQL连接池?

1. 配置连接池大小

连接池大小是指连接池中可以存放的最大连接数。在配置连接池大小时,需要考虑到应用程序的并发访问量和MySQL服务器的负载能力。连接池大小应该设置为应用程序预计的最大并发访问量的两倍左右。

2. 配置连接超时时间

连接超时时间是指连接在空闲状态下可以保持的最长时间。如果连接在超时时间内没有被使用,连接池会自动关闭该连接。连接超时时间的设置应该考虑到应用程序的访问模式和MySQL服务器的负载情况。连接超时时间应该设置为几分钟到几小时之间。

3. 配置最大空闲连接数

最大空闲连接数是指连接池中可以保持的最大空闲连接数。如果连接池中的连接数超过了最大空闲连接数,连接池会自动关闭一些连接,从而释放资源。最大空闲连接数的设置应该考虑到应用程序的访问模式和MySQL服务器的负载情况。最大空闲连接数应该设置为连接池大小的一半左右。

四、如何使用MySQL连接池?

在使用MySQL连接池时,应用程序可以通过连接池管理器获取连接,然后使用该连接进行数据库操作。在完成数据库操作后,应用程序应该将连接返回到连接池中,以便其他应用程序可以继续使用该连接。

MySQL连接池是Web开发中非常重要的组件之一,它可以提高网站的性能和稳定性。在配置MySQL连接池时,需要考虑到应用程序的访问模式和MySQL服务器的负载情况。在使用MySQL连接池时,应用程序应该通过连接池管理器获取连接,并在完成数据库操作后将连接返回到连接池中。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。